WebAug 8, 2024 · Chronic diarrhea is defined as loose/watery stools, which occur three or more times within 24 hours and lasts for 4 or more weeks. This activity outlines the evaluation and treatment of chronic diarrhea … WebChronic diarrhea, associated with impaired nutritional status, may be a serious condition, and therapy should be started promptly. The treatment includes general supportive measures, nutritional rehabilitation, elimination diets and drugs. The latter are frequently introduced empirically, pending stool testing results.

WebChronic dysentery develops either after several attacks of the acute form or directly from the first acute attack, which after some periods of improvement persists to a greater or less extent. Cases of chronic dysentery are also divided into three categories: (1) The Mild Form. The general nutrition is not interfered with.
